[PATCH 2/2] mfd: qcom-pm8008: support PMICs with no interrupt line

The interrupt is only needed for the temperature alarm and the two GPIOs. Where the pin is not routed the regulators are still perfectly usable, but probe fails: client->irq is 0 and request_threaded_irq() rejects it. Skip the IRQ chip in that case and register the regulator cell alone. The temperature alarm cannot be registered without a domain either, because its IORESOURCE_IRQ would be handed to the platform device as a raw number rather than being mapped, and the GPIO cell needs the domain for the same reason.
